> If you can find the config file, maybe hand editing is an option. To
> find the right file maybe this will help.
>
> $ grep -i -e mouse -r ~/.config/xfce4/
That does indeed find and display the name of the file. Editing
<property name="ReverseScrolling" type="bool" value="false"/>
from "true" to "false" followed with a log-out and log-in does change
the setting.
Checking the box in the GUI in the 'Settings" window has no effect.
